Officials in Missouri have launched a criminal inquiry into Governor Eric Greitens, amid a claim that he took nude photos of a woman without her consent. The spurned ex-husband of the woman, who has not been named in reports, secretly recorded her describing the otherwise consensual encounter.
The governor of Missouri has admitted to being "unfaithful" to his wife, but denies claims that he blackmailed a woman to stay quiet about their affair. Republican Governor Eric Greitens acknowledged an affair after a local television outlet aired a salacious recording by the woman's ex-husband.
Judy Henderson was sentenced to 50 years to life in 1982 for what even the trial judge at the time called her "relatively minor” role in a robbery-turned-murder. Missouri Governor's Office. A Missouri convict is now a free woman after the state governor commuted her lengthy sentence after 35 years behind ...
Since 2004, three Missouri governors turned down Judy Henderson's petition for clemency. But today, in a surprising announcement from a politician who frequently stresses his respect for law and order, Governor Eric Greitens commuted the life sentence of Judy Henderson, freeing the 68-year-old ...
